Transaction 5512ad0a7e038ba783162044846f33664c0c9c72aa604b93f65c1af4efd6a948
1 Input
1 Output
-
5512ad0a7e038ba783162044846f33664c0c9c72aa604b93f65c1af4efd6a948:0
- value
- 18809346
- script pubkey
- OP_0 OP_PUSHBYTES_20 de5a105ac2d676d71a3f2bb92b309657a39b5a24
- address
- bc1qmedpqkkz6emdwx3l9wujkvyk273ekk3ycvrdm2